Price for Frozen Boneless Cuts of Bovine Meat in Myanmar (CIF) - 2022

The average import price for frozen boneless cuts of bovine meat stood at $9,002 per ton in 2022, jumping by 214% against the previous year. Over the period under review, the import price showed a resilient expansion. As a result, import price reached the peak level and is likely to continue growth in the immediate term.

Prices varied noticeably by country of origin: am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was Australia ($10,064 per ton), while the price for India amounted to $2,599 per ton.

From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Nepal (-2.6%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ced a decline.

Price for Frozen Boneless Cuts of Bovine Meat in Myanmar (FOB) - 2022

The average export price for frozen boneless cuts of bovine meat stood at $650 per ton in 2022, approximately reflecting the previous year. Overall, the export price showed a abrupt contraction.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2020 a decrease of -5.3% against the previous year. The export price peaked at $5,138 per ton in 2017; however, from 2018 to 2022, the export prices stood at a somewhat lower figure.

As there is only one major export destination, the average price level is determined by prices for Hong Kong SAR.

From 2012 to 2022, the rate of growth in terms of prices for China amounted to -3.9% per year.

Imports of Frozen Boneless Cuts of Bovine Meat in Myanmar

For the third year in a row, Myanmar recorded decline in overseas purchases of frozen boneless cuts of bovine meat, which decreased by -47% to 95 tons in 2022. Over the period under review, imports continue to indicate a precipitous decrease. The smallest decline of -26% was in 2020.

In value terms, imports of frozen boneless cuts of bovine meat soared to $854K in 2022. In general, imports saw a precipitous curtailment.

Exports of Frozen Boneless Cuts of Bovine Meat in Myanmar

For the third consecutive year, Myanmar recorded decline in overseas shipments of frozen boneless cuts of bovine meat, which decreased by 0% to 48 tons in 2022. In general, exports showed a dramatic curtailment. The smallest decline of -95.4% was in 2020.

In value terms, exports of frozen boneless cuts of bovine meat amounted to $31K in 2022. Over the period under review, exports saw a sharp shrinkage. The smallest decline of -95.7% was in 2020.
